Pen range with a minimum of 50% recycled plastic*
Virgin plastic is one of the largest source of impact across a pen’s lifecycle accounting for more than 75% of it. That’s why recycled content is where PLUS+ concentrates its effort.
By using recycled plastic instead of virgin one, PILOT reduces the CO2 impact of its pens by between 26% and 59%, depending on the product (CSR Report 2026, p.18).
*Out of total product weight
Refillable pens
“Don’t bin it. Refill it. ยป
70% of pens PILOT sells in Europe are refillable*
Refilling isn’t just a nice idea, it’s measurable: refilling one FriXion Ball three times instead of buying four single-use pens reduces its CO2 impact by 62%*
Most PILOT writing instruments are designed to be refilled, not replaced: ballpoint pens, rollerballs, whiteboard markers, foutanis pens. When the ink runs out, a refill or cartridge does the job : same pen, same performance, a fraction of the material.
*CSR Report 2026, p,49 & p.22
RECLAIM
PILOT’s B2P range includes plastic collected from oceans, rivers and beaches as part of its recycled content.
Since the range launched, more than 1.4 tons of ocean and river plastic have been incorporated into over 10 million B2P pens*
*(CSR Report 2026, p.23)

Why did Begreen become PLUS+?
Begreen was PILOT’s eco-designed range name since 2006. We renamed it PLUS+ and changed how we present it: an independent certifier and a percentage now calculated on the total weight of the product, in line with the latest European rules on environmental claims. The products themselves haven’t changed.
-
What does the percentage on a PLUS+ product mean?
It’s the share of recycled plastic in the finished product, calculated on its total weight and verified by an independent certifier. Every PLUS+ product contains at least 50% recycled plastic on this basis.
-
Why do some percentages look lower than before?
We changed our calculation method and our independent certifier. The new percentage is based on the total weight of the finished product, a stricter basis than before. A lower looking number doesn’t mean less recycled plastic, it means a more precise way of measuring it.
-
Is every PILOT pen part of PLUS+?
No. PLUS+ brings together the products that reach the 50% recycled plastic threshold under our current methodology. As certification is updated product by product, a pen can join or leave the range.
